    Learn more about Food and Beverage Technology Bachelors degree programs

    Food and Beverage Technology degree programs at the Bachelor’s level offer a chance to delve into the science behind food production, preservation, and innovation. You’ll explore various elements of the food industry, from quality control to sustainable practices, providing a solid foundation for your career.

    Through courses in food processing, beverage technology, and nutrition, students learn how to analyze and improve production methods. You'll gain specialized skills, such as developing quality assurance protocols and formulating new food products. Students strengthen their creativity as they design innovative recipes and assess consumer trends.

    This degree equips you for diverse roles, whether you want to work in quality assurance, food safety management, or product development. The environment fosters collaboration and encourages critical thinking, preparing you for the dynamic food and beverage sector, where your contributions can impact health and sustainability.
